In the realm of industrial automation, two titans, ABB and Schneider Electric, stand as undisputed leaders. Both companies supply a comprehensive suite of advanced technologies designed to optimize manufacturing processes across diverse verticals. While both share a common goal of enhancing industrial efficiency and reliability, their approaches diverge in noteworthy ways. ABB, with its strong roots in robotics and drive technology, focuses solutions for automated systems. On the other hand, Schneider Electric's prowess lies in its wide-ranging portfolio of electrical distribution products and services, catering to a broader spectrum of industrial needs.
This distinction emerges in their respective technology stacks. ABB is renowned for its collaborative robots, while Schneider Electric stands out with its energy-efficient infrastructure . Ultimately, the choice between these two industry leaders depends on the specific requirements of each industrial application.

Global Competition in Industrial Automation: Benchmarking ABB, Siemens, Rockwell Automation, and Schneider Electric
The international market for industrial automation is highly fierce, with leading players vying for customers. Among these industry giants, ABB, Siemens, Rockwell Automation, and Schneider Electric stand out as key contenders, each offering a comprehensive portfolio of solutions.
ABB, known for its robotics and electrification expertise, concentrates on areas like factory automation and motion control. Siemens, a international powerhouse, boasts a broad range of products spanning from PLCs to systems. Rockwell Automation, an American giant, shines in the industrial automation space with its flexible control systems and software platform. Finally, Schneider Electric, a European conglomerate, specializes in energy management solutions and industrial automation.
